For the first time, Chastity Bono shares the moving story of her early adulthood: how her traumatic tabloid outing as the openly gay daughter of Sonny and Cher threatened her burgeoning musical career, and how her first true love was taken from her by cancer. At an early age, Chastity survived challenges many of us never face. A story of love won and lost, of dreams fulfilled and destroyed, The End of Innocence is a coming-of-age story that provides a deeply personal look into the private struggles of a very public and courageous woman.Chastity Bono was first known as the daughter of Sonny Bono and Cher, when she made appearances on her parents' TV show, The Sonny and Cher Comedy Hour. She established her own identity after coming out on the cover of The Advocate in 1995 and went on to become a reporter for the magazine. Since then, she's worked as the 1996 National Coming Out Project's spokesperson for the HRC. From 1997 to 1998, she was the Entertainment -Media Director for GLAAD. She is also the author of the bestselling Family Outing and continues to lecture around the country. Michele Kort is an award-winning journalist whose writing has appeared in the Los Angeles Times Magazine, L.A. Weekly, Shape, Redbook, Self and The Advocate. A Los Angeles resident, she is also the author of Soul Picnic: The Music and Passion of Laura Nyro. - from Amzon
